SCHENECTADY, N.Y. -- The victim of an assault in Schenectady has died at Ellis Hospital.

Police say they received a 911 call around 9 p.m. Thursday about two people involved in an altercation. They say Harold Gotti, 43, was found unresponsive on the sidewalk in front of 1255 State Street and later died at the hospital. Police say according to witnesses, it was two people against one.

"No arrests. Cause of death at this time is unknown. He is scheduled for an autopsy tomorrow afternoon," said Schenectady Police Department Lieutenant Mark McCracken.

Police say it does not appear that any weapons were used during the assault.
